| Course Name |
Eligibility Criteria |
| B.V.Sc & A.H Programme |
- Candidates who have passed or are appearing in 10+2 (Intermediate) with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ology, and English are eligible.
|
| M.V.Sc and Ph.D (Veterinary Science) Programme |
- Candidates who have passed or are appearing in B.V.Sc. & A.H. are eligible.
- For Doctorate programs, a M.V.Sc. degree in the relevant subject is required.
|
| B.Tech Biotechnology |
- Candidates must have passed 10+2 or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ology/Mathematics, and English.
- General/OBC category: Minimum 60% marks
- SC/ST category: Minimum 55% marks
|
| Bachelor of Technology (Diary Technology) |
- Candidates should have passed 10+2 or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, Biology or Mathematics, and English.
- General/OBC: Minimum 60% marks
- SC/ST: Minimum 55% marks
|
| Bachelor of Fisheries Science |
- Candidates must have passed 10+2 or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ology, and English.
- General/OBC: At least 60% marks
- SC/ST: At least 55% marks
|
| M.Sc (Biotechnology) / M.V.Sc (Biotechnology) / Ph.D (Biotechnology) |
- Candidates applying for M.Sc must have a Bachelor’s degree in Life Sciences or Biological Sciences. For M.V.Sc, a degree in Veterinary Science is required. M.Tech applicants should have a 4-year Engineering degree with Biology or a related subject studied at 10+2 or later. For Doctorate programs, candidates need a Master’s degree (M.Sc/M.Tech in a relevant science field or M.V.Sc). General/OBC candidates must have at least 60% marks, and SC/ST candidates need 55%.
|
| Diploma in Veterinary Pharmacy & Livestock Extension in Institute of Para-Veterinary Sciences |
- Candidates who have passed or are appearing in 10+2 (Intermediate) with Physics, Chemistry, Biology, and English are eligible.
- General/OBC: Minimum 50% marks
- SC/ST: Minimum 45% marks
